Voice Extraction and Synthesis for Language Learning

One of the most powerful educational uses of Udio is its ability to isolate or synthesize voices from any audio source. For language teachers, this means they can extract clear speech from songs, podcasts, or dialogues, then adjust the pace, pitch, or even accent. Students can practice listening comprehension by hearing the same sentence spoken at different speeds. Furthermore, Udio’s voice synthesis can generate natural-sounding examples in multiple languages, helping learners mimic pronunciation and intonation. This bridges the gap between textbook exercises and real-world conversational contexts.

AI-Powered Remixing for Music Education

In music classrooms, Udio AI Remix with Voice allows students to deconstruct complex compositions into individual stems—vocals, drums, bass, melody. They can then remix these elements to understand structural composition. For instance, a student studying jazz can isolate the piano and vocal tracks to analyze improvisation techniques. The AI adaptively suggests alternative chord progressions or rhythmic patterns, turning passive listening into active exploration. This hands-on approach aligns with constructivist learning theories.

English as a Second Language (ESL) Classes

In an ESL classroom, a teacher imports a popular English song and uses Udio to extract the vocal line. The AI then generates multiple versions: one with slow, clear enunciation, another with natural speech speed, and a third with a regional accent (e.g., British vs. American). Students practice shadowing—repeating after the AI—while the tool provides instant feedback on pitch and rhythm. The teacher can also create fill-in-the-blank exercises by muting specific words.

How to Use Udio AI Remix with Voice: A Step-by-Step Guide

Getting started with Udio is straightforward, even for those with no technical background. Here is a simple workflow for educators.

  • Step 1: Access the Platform – Visit Udio Official Website and create a free account. The web-based interface works on any modern browser, requiring no installation.
  • Step 2: Upload or Select Audio – Import an audio file (MP3, WAV, etc.) from your device or choose from Udio’s royalty-free library. For educational purposes, public domain music or your own recordings are recommended.
  • Step 3: Process Voice and Music – Use the “Separate Vocals” button to isolate the voice track. The AI will analyze the audio and produce clean stems within seconds. You can then adjust the volume, pitch, and speed of the voice independently.
  • Step 4: Remix and Customize – Select a remix style (e.g., acoustic, upbeat, classical) or let the AI generate variations. Add your own voice narration or student recordings by clicking “Overlay Voice.” The tool synchronizes everything automatically.
  • Step 5: Export and Share – Download the final mix as a high-quality audio file or share a private link with students via your learning management system (LMS). Udio also supports embedding into Google Classroom and Canvas.
